Glasgow Ceph storage
- RAL xrootd was tried
- Identified that some performance tuning options, when under high loads caused too many concurrent threads and truncation of the cached files
- Moved back to on disk cache (on SSDs)
- Getting data to the jobs looks much better now.
- Stage-ing back from jobs and redirection is next, to work between all three caches (one currently running)
- Ceph-tuning for timeouts; stability improving; awaiting updated nautilaus for fixes to some current work-arounds
- Bandwith looks good and is maxing out the gridFTP box.
- Different versions of xroot on the various services: gateway 4.12.2, cache 4.11.3; aim to upgrade when possible
